05 r53 electrical issues

Hey all. On my way to work this morning I had some scary electrical gremlins. First my seatbelt light came on, next my indicator lights stopped working. Soon after my emergency flashers turned themselves on. Parked restarted, got to work, but my dash lighting wouldn't turn off. Disconnected the battery and everything seemed fine for a few minutes until the indicators refused to work. Lights and signals are working just fine on the outside of the car. It's also running fine. I've been ignoring a wheel speed sensor all winter but I can't imagine that suddenly caused all of this. Checked some fuses, did an ECU reset, but haven't dug any deeper yet. I did find a slight bit of moisture in the battery compartment. Any ideas?
